Understand the Connection Between TMJ, Sleep, and Airway Health | Episode 71 with Dr. Emily Levy
from The Little Brain Campaign · host Dr. Lauren LaRose MD
Emily Levy is a dentist at Billings Family Dentistry, and she joins us for a third, deeper conversation on TMJ, this time focusing on sleep and sleep-breathing disorders. We dig into why so many symptoms are dismissed as “normal” simply because they’re common, and how sleep issues are frequently missed in both medical and dental care. Emily breaks down how airway obstruction, neurologic regulation, and craniofacial structure all intersect with TMJ, pain, and overall health, and why proper screening matters for both kids and adults.We also talk through the real-world signs of sleep-breathing disorders, from snoring misconceptions and bruxism to behavioral issues, anxiety, learning challenges, and bedwetting in kids. Emily explains why quick fixes like night guards or tonsillectomy alone often miss the root problem, and how early, functional intervention can lead to meaningful improvements in sleep, development, and quality of life.
